		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>A Colombian colleague and I went to La Strada recently and he was delighted at having found authentic Peruvian food so close to our office. I&#8217;d been once before with my wife and had the stewed chicken, but this time I had the stewed tripe (callos). It was absolutely delicious. The tripe wasn&#8217;t at all tough or gooey or sticky, as it can be, it was perfectly done, retaining enough of it&#8217;s fibrousness to have a pleasant toothsomeness.</p>
<p>And, most recently, I went there today and had the stewed oxtail. It was good and tasty but the stew sauce didn&#8217;t have much oxtail flavor, sadly, nothing like as good as this <a href="http://www.weareneverfull.com/asturian-oxtail-rabo-de-buey-asturiano-remaking-a-delicious-spanish-meal/" rel="nofollow">Spanish oxtail recipe</a>.</p>

		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Check out Utopia Cafe on W56 between 5/6Av, middle of the block on the south side, across from Sophie&#8217;s. It&#8217;s less crowded, cheaper, cleaner and friendlier. They&#8217;re Puerto Rican and Dominican rather than Cuban, so they have rice with gandules and dishes like sancocho (which rocks), along with pernil and oxtail and the other usual suspects.</p>

		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>La Strada is indeed dirty, but it embraces its dirtyness, which I prefer.  If you look carefully, you can see behind the curtain into the kitchen, but I wouldn&#8217;t recommend it.  Another tip&#8211;go for the homemade green salsa (in the refrigerator case).  It is provided for no extra charge, but only the regulars know it is hands down better than the red sauce in the basket by the register.  I&#8217;ve been to LaStrada at least 30 times and never seen anyone having a slice of pizza.</p>
